The Importance of Emergency Boarding Up
Emergency boarding up serves numerous important functions:
Prevent Further Damage: After a catastrophe, open doors and windows develop vulnerabilities that can cause water damage, theft, or vandalism. Boarding up these openings is important to avoid additional losses.
Security: Boarded-up properties are less attractive to prospective intruders. This added layer of protection can discourage criminal activity throughout the vulnerable period following a catastrophe.
Insurance Compliance: Many insurance service providers need homeowner to take instant steps to secure their property after a loss. Boarding up can typically be a prerequisite for filing claims successfully with insurance companies.
Safety: In the case of broken glass or unstable structures, boarding up makes sure that individuals can not unintentionally hurt themselves on the property.
Area Integrity: An unboarded property can interfere with neighborhood visual appeals and security. Properly securing the building assists keep area worths.
The Process of Emergency Boarding Up
The boarding-up process involves several key actions:
Assess the Damage: Before any boarding up can start, examine the degree and location of the damage. Determine which doors and windows need boarding and ensure that no people are trapped inside.
Gather Materials: The most common products for boarding up consist of plywood sheets, screws, nails, and protective equipment. Local hardware stores typically bring these products.
Measure and Cut: Carefully determine the openings to be covered. Cut the plywood sheets to fit firmly over each opening. A snug fit is essential to guarantee they remain in place.
Secure the Boards: Fasten the cut plywood sheets over the openings utilizing screws or heavy-duty nails. Ensure that the boards are well-secured to withstand wind, more damage, or tried burglaries.
Assess for Future Repairs: Once the property is protected, plan for repairs. Seek advice from local contractors to acquire estimates for bring back the property to its initial condition.

Q1: How long does it take to board up my property?
A: The time needed to board up a property can differ depending upon the extent of the damage and the number of openings. Typically, it can take a couple of hours.
Q2: Will my insurance cover the expense of boarding up?
A: Many insurance plan include provisions for emergency boarding up. It's important to review your policy or speak to your insurance representative for specifics.
Q3: Can I do the boarding up myself?
A: Yes, if you have the required tools and materials, you can board up your property. However, if the damage is comprehensive or harmful, it's advised to hire professionals.
Q4: How do I select a trustworthy boarding-up service?
A: Look for evaluations and rankings online, request recommendations from buddies or family, and guarantee the company is licensed and guaranteed.
Q5: What products are best for boarding up?
A: Plywood is the most typically utilized material for boarding up doors and windows. It's long lasting and supplies good protection against the aspects and burglars.
